WebSize. Minimum height for dogs: 79 cms (31 ins), bitches: 71 cms (28 ins). Minimum weight: 54.5 kgs (120 lbs) for dogs, 40.9 kgs (90 lbs) for bitches. Great size, including height of shoulder and proportionate length of body is to be aimed at, and it is desired to firmly establish a breed that shall average from 81-86 cms (32-34 ins) in dogs. The Irish wolfhound is a large ... ear piercing simsbury ctWebMar 9, 2024 · Irish wolfhounds were originally bred to be hunting dogs. Specifically, they were bred to chase down large animals, including wolves. These dogs are sighthounds, which means they hunt primarily with sight and speed rather than smell and endurance. ear piercing solution walmartWebApr 27, 2024 · As the tallest dog breed, this Irish Wolfhound has astounding height.
